    Las Vegas – UFC BJJ® returns once again with another thrilling card featuring some of the biggest names in grappling going head-to-head in can’t-miss matchups. In the main event, UFC BJJ light heavyweight champion Mason Fowler looks to continue building his legacy as he faces new challenger Devhonte Johnson. Also on the card, former UFC welterweight title challenger Gilbert Burns returns to the mats to face Horlando Monteiro.
    UFC BJJ 9: FOWLER vs JOHNSON takes place Thursday, June 4th and will stream live and free on UFC BJJ’s YouTube channel beginning at 8 p.m. ET/5 p.m. PT.
    UFC BJJ 9: FOWLER vs JOHNSON tickets are on-sale now and are available at AXS.com.
    Media members wishing to apply for credentials may sign up here.
    Fan favorite Fowler (2-0, 1 submission, competing out of San Jose, Calif.) plans to deliver his most emphatic performance yet for his second UFC BJJ title defense. Owner of one of the most diverse submission games in the light heavyweight division, Fowler has proven himself in performances over Pedro Machado, David Garmo and Christiano Troisi. He now looks to retain his spot at the top of the division by taking out Johnson.
    Johnson (1-0, competing out of Paterson, N.J.) intends to make a statement in his sophomore UFC BJJ outing of 2026. Originally competing at heavyweight, he showed off his grappling ability in his debut win over Lucas Norat. Johnson now seeks to prove that he can compete with the best in the world at 205-pounds by upsetting Fowler and claiming UFC BJJ gold.
    UFC veteran Burns (0-0, competing out of Boca Raton, Fla.) seeks to make a definitive splash in his UFC BJJ debut. A multiple-time grappling world champion before transitioning to MMA, ‘Dorinho’ has recorded wins over Leandro Lo, Kron Gracie and Rafael Lavato Jr. He now has his sights set on immediately inserting his name into the middleweight title conversation with another signature submission.
    Monteiro (0-0, competing out of Kona, Hawaii) looks to earn the biggest victory on his career in his UFC BJJ debut. Widely regarded as an incredibly talented grappler, he earned his reputation in the lower belt divisions claiming IBJJF and UAEJJF world championships. Monteiro now plans to secure a breakout performance in the UFC BJJ Bowl by defeating Burns.

    Belgrade, Serbia: UFC, the world’s premier mixed martial arts organisation, makes its historic debut in Belgrade as No. 13 ranked welterweight Uros Medic faces off against No.15 ranked Daniel Rodriguez on Saturday, 1 August, at the Belgrade Arena.
    Tickets will go on sale at 10 a.m. CEST on Friday, May 29, via tickets.rs. Fight Club members will have the opportunity to purchase tickets early at 10 a.m. CEST on Wednesday, May 27, whilst those who registered their interest early in this event will gain access at 10 a.m. CEST on Thursday, May 28.
    UFC fans can take their experience to the next level with an exclusive VIP package. Fans can enjoy premium seating, access to a private all-inclusive lounge with food and drinks, opportunities to meet and take photos with UFC athletes, and the unforgettable chance to step inside the iconic UFC Octagon® after the event. For more information, fans can visit tickets.rs to view package details.
    Making its long-awaited debut in Serbia, UFC descends on Belgrade for a landmark night inside the Octagon. With world-class talent assembled from across the globe, the event is shaping up to be an unmissable night of action.
    Uros Medic (13-3-0, fighting out of Anchorage, Alaska by way of Novi Sad, Serbia) steps into the Octagon armed with striking precision that has made him one of the most dangerous finishers in the welterweight division. The ranked contender has put together a string of impressive performances, including consecutive first-round stoppage wins over of Geoff Neal, Gilbert Urbina, and Muslim Salikhov, and arrives in Belgrade hungry to cement his place among the division’s elite.
    Daniel Rodriguez (20-5-0, fighting out Alhambra, California) has emerged as a fixture in the welterweight rankings as a result of his crisp, technical boxing and steely approach inside the Octagon. Rodriguez enters on a three-fight winning streak, having most recently bested Kevin Holland at UFC 318, and now he heads to Belgrade looking to secure the biggest win of his career.

    Las Vegas – UFC International Fight Week returns to Las Vegas, headlined by a thrilling rematch that will see former two-division UFC champion Conor McGregor collide with former featherweight titleholder Max Holloway in a rematch 13 years in the making. Also, an exciting lightweight contenders’ bout sees No. 5 ranked contender Benoit Saint Denis battle No. 6 Paddy Pimblett.
    UFC® 329: MCGREGOR vs. HOLLOWAY 2 takes place Saturday, July 11 at T-Mobile Arena with the main card starting at 9 p.m. ET / 6 p.m. PT on Paramount+. The prelims will begin at 7 p.m. ET / 4 p.m. PT. The early prelims will kick off at 5 p.m. ET / 2 p.m. PT on Paramount+ and UFC Fight Pass.
    UFC® 329: MCGREGOR vs. HOLLOWAY 2 tickets will go on sale Friday, May 29 at 10 a.m. PT and are available at AXS.com. Ticket sales are limited to eight (8) per person. UFC Fight Club ® will have the opportunity to purchase tickets Wednesday, May 27 at 10 a.m. PT via the website UFCFightClub.com. A special Internet ticket pre-sale will be available to UFC newsletter subscribers Thursday, May 28 at 10 a.m. ET. To access the pre-sale, users must register for the UFC newsletter through UFC.com
    UFC VIP Experience packages are available via On Location, UFC’s Official VIP Experience Provider. Enjoy exclusive access with an official ticket package that includes premium seating, all-inclusive hospitality, in-seat beverage service, meet-and-greets with UFC Octagon Girls and more. Visit UFCVIP.com for more information.
    McGregor (22-6, fighting out of Dublin, Ireland) returns to action for the first time in five years looking for a vintage performance. A devastating striker, he holds thrilling KO wins against Eddie Alvarez, Jose Aldo and Donald Cerrone. McGregor plans to remind fans why he is one of the greatest fighters ever by securing a second victory over Holloway.
     
    Holloway (27-9, fighting out of Waianae, Hawaii) intends to spoil McGregor’s return with a highlight-reel finish. A former BMF titleholder, he has earned memorable wins against Justin Gaethje, Chan Sung Jung and Brian Ortega. Holloway now looks to even the score by stopping McGregor in emphatic fashion.
    Saint Denis (17-3 1NC, fighting out of Paris, France) steps back in the Octagon following an impressive TKO win against Dan Hooker in February.  Currently riding a four-fight win streak, he also holds notable victories over Beneil Dariush, Mauricio Ruffy and Matt Frevola. Saint Denis now plans to finish Pimblett and stake his claim for a title shot.
    Pimblett (23-4, fighting out of Liverpool, Merseyside, England) is coming off his Fight of the Year candidate against Justin Gaethje in January. A relentless competitor, he has delivered exciting victories over Michael Chandler, King Green and Tony Ferguson. Pimblett aims to halt Saint Denis’ momentum to crack the lightweight Top 5.

    As Alex Pereira looks to make history for himself by becoming a three-division UFC Champion, he is currently in the middle of bulking up and ensuring he is in fighter shape when the time comes to fight Ciryl Gane at the White House for the interim UFC Heavyweight Championship.

    Former UFC Bantamweight Champion, Sean O’Malley is also fighting on the card, but was asked about the transformation made by Pereira and kept it very honest when answering about the size of Pereira in his heavyweight setting.

    “His ass is bigger than a Miami b*tch’s BBL. It was mind-blowing. Holy sh*t. If I didn’t know better, I might’ve f*cking jacked off. It was huge. I looked at his butt for like 7 seconds.”

    Pereira defeated Israel Adesanya to become the Middleweight Champion before moving up and defeating Jiri Prochazka. He will now fight Gane on June 14 at the White House to crown an interim Heavyweight Champion to determine who fights for the Undisputed gold against Tom Aspinall when cleared.

    Ultimate Fighting Championship has announced that they will be returning to Oklahoma City, Oklahoma on Saturday, July 18th, 2026, for UFC Fight Night from the Paycom Center.

    UFC sent out the following press release regarding their upcoming Fight Night Oklahoma City event:

    UFC FIGHT NIGHT OKLAHOMA CITY to be held Saturday, July 18 at Paycom Center

    Las Vegas – UFC, the world’s premier mixed martial arts organization, in partnership with Paycom Center and Visit Oklahoma City, today announced UFC’s return to Oklahoma City on Saturday, July 18.

    UFC® FIGHT NIGHT OKLAHOMA CITY looks to deliver a can’t-miss card filled with thrilling matchups featuring some of UFC’s biggest stars, top contenders and rising prospects. Fans in Oklahoma can expect a night of excitement and entertainment as UFC continues to bring the best in mixed martial arts to cities around the world.

    “We are thrilled to return to an incredible destination like Oklahoma City,” said UFC Executive Vice President of Event Development Peter Dropick. “Thank you to Paycom Center and Visit OKC for their continued partnership and we look forward to delivering a great event this July.”
    “We are honored to host the first UFC event in Oklahoma in nearly 10 years,” said Paycom Center General Manager, Chris Semrau. “The community has been asking for this kind of event for years, and we’re very excited to finally bring the highest level of MMA back to Oklahoma City. This will surely be one of the major events of the summer for the region.”

    “Visit Oklahoma City is beyond excited for the return of the UFC to our market after many years,” said Visit OKC Vice President of Sports Development, Adam Wisniewski. “Our city takes pride in hosting the country’s most premier sporting events, and bringing another UFC Fight Night is something we are very much looking forward to adding to Oklahoma City’s resume. We can hardly wait to welcome thousands of fans to Oklahoma City and to assist in producing an event our city will talk about for years to come!”

    UFC® FIGHT NIGHT OKLAHOMA CITY marks the first UFC event in the region since UFC FIGHT NIGHT: CHIESA vs LEEon June 25, 2017 and will be the third overall event in Oklahoma City in UFC history, as it also hosted UFC FIGHT NIGHT: DIAZ vs GUILLARD on September 16, 2009.
